About this piece

Canon Triplex is a contemporary contrapuntal study by Rob Peters. It explores strict imitative techniques within a modern harmonic framework.

Teacher notes

Maintaining rhythmic precision across the three independent voices is the primary challenge.

How hard is Canon Triplex (Op.14) by Rob Peters?

Canon Triplex (Op.14) is rated Henle level 4 of 9 — intermediate repertoire, roughly ABRSM grades 5–6. In the RCM system it corresponds to about level 6.

What level do I need to play Canon Triplex?

You should be comfortable at Henle level 4 — meaning you can already play level 3–4 pieces cleanly. Learning it one level early is possible as a stretch piece, but more than that usually leads to months of frustration.

How long is Canon Triplex?

A typical performance of Canon Triplex (Op.14) lasts about 3 minutes.
